Internal checklists for restoration steps

Purpose

1. Automate and centralize internal checklists for restoration steps, ensuring every stage of artwork restoration is tracked, verified, and updated in real-time.

2. Standardize workflow, minimize missed steps, automate approvals, and generate audit trails.

3. Enable collaboration among restorers, supervisors, and stakeholders, automating communication and status reporting.

4. Automate reminders, escalations, and documentation for compliance and quality assurance.

5. Integrate with project management and document storage, automating artifact tracking across digital platforms.


Trigger Conditions

1. Project intake or initiation of a new artwork restoration process.

2. Change in restoration phase (e.g., inspection, cleaning, repair, finishing).

3. Completion, update, or verification of any checklist item by a team member.

4. Scheduled time-based triggers for progress reviews or deadline reminders.

5. External input (e.g., client approval, regulatory update, supply delivery).
